Why Kerala
Kerala is the spice capital of India. The Western Ghats, with their high altitude, heavy monsoon rains, and mineral-rich soil, create growing conditions that no other region can replicate. Spices grown here carry a depth of aroma and flavour that has made Kerala the source of choice for traders, chefs, and home cooks for centuries. This is the land where cardamom, pepper, cloves, and turmeric have been cultivated for generations, not as a commodity, but as a way of life.

Malabar Coast — Tellicherry Black Pepper Tellicherry is not a separate variety of pepper. It is the finest grade of Malabar black pepper, named after the historic port city of Thalasseri in northern Kerala. Only the largest, most mature peppercorns measuring 4.25mm or above qualify for the Tellicherry grade. The result is a pepper with bold aroma, citrus notes, and a warmth that is rounded rather than sharp.
